When we booked this property, we thought it looked nice, but none of the pictures truly prepared us for what awaited. This has to be one of the most wonderful, spacious, and comfortable properties we have ever stayed in abroad, and we have stayed in a fair few!
The house itself is so roomy, and your every need is catered for, from the American-style fridge, with iced water on tap, to the coffee maker. With two teenagers, we particularly valued there being double beds in each of the rooms, as well as separate showers/bathrooms. Everybody had plenty of space to relax in, and, with nine different seating areas to choose from, there was something for everyone. Fans in each of the rooms were a huge bonus as well.
The pool and gardens were just wonderful. We hadn't realised just how much land surrounded the property. The whole place felt truly luxurious.
The town of Cotignac was lovely. Unfortunately you can't really walk into town from the property, which was a real shame, but parking was easy (except on market day), and so we really didn't mind. There are plenty of lovely restaurants to choose from (booking HIGHLY recommended to avoid disappointment), but we particularly enjoyed eating crepes and drinking coffee at the local cafes in the mornings. It's a lovely town to simply wander around, and the market on a Tuesday morning is a real treat.
All in all, this is the most wonderful property, on the outskirts of a lovely town, in the most beautiful part of France. Highly recommended.
